## **`OBJECTIVES AND ACTIVITIES`** 

## **`Principal Activities`** 

```
TheprincipalobjectiveandactivityoftheCompanyconsistsofofferingfriendshipandinformal,practical and
emotionalsupporttoparentswithyoungchildrenthroughouttheFarnham,Haslemere,Godalmingand Cranleigh
areasofSurreysothateverychildintheareacanhaveagoodstartinlife.TheCompanyplacestrained volunteers
alongsideparents,tailoringsupportto theindividualneedsof eachfamily,foras longas it is needed.Nocharges are
levied for any help provided by the Company which acts purely as a charity.

## **`ACHIEVEMENTS AND PERFORMANCE Charitable activities`** 

## **`Backdrop`** 

```
2024/25has been anothervery challengingyear for everyone.The financialcrisisthe countryis facingis now coupled
witha stagnanteconomy,furthercutbacksinbothcentralandlocalgovernmentfundingandanever-increasing cost
ofliving.Facedwiththesechallengesthedemandforourservicescontinuedtobehighwithfamilieshaving many
complex needs.
```

```
Thecutbacksinpublicspendinghavemeantthatmoreandmorecharitiesareexperiencingfinancial difficulties
meaning we are all competing for the same funding.
```

```
Andlastlytheriseincostoflivinghashadaseriousimpactontheavailabilityofpeopletohelpandthereisnow a
recognised national shortage of volunteers.
```

```
Againstthisratherdepressingbackdropweareverypleasedtoreportthattheteamhaverisentoallthe challenges
and maintained a strong support service across the year.
```

## **`Need`** 

```
Manyof ourfamilieshave facedvery complexneedsandas a resulthave requiredsupportfor muchlonger.Some 33
families have had 5 or more needs recorded when we first visit them. 17% have needed support for over 3 years.
```

```
Mostmarkedly,95%ofourfamilieshavementalhealthissuesoraresufferingfromisolation.45%aresingle parent
families. Financial difficulties remain a key issue for many and is especially high among our single parent families.
```

```
30%arefamilieswhereoneparenthasadisability.20%recordhistoricaldomesticabuseandaslastyear SEND
continues to increase and is often noted on referrals or at initial visits.
```

## **`Numbers`** 

```
Referralshaveremainedhighat84(lastyear88)withanincreasingnumberofself-referrals.Acrosstheyear 79
volunteers, staff and group work have supported 193 families including 355 children.
```

```
Weareextremelygratefultoallourvolunteersforalltheirhelpandsupport.Theglowingtestimonialsfrom our
families says it all.
```

## **`What we've done`** 

```
Asinpreviousyearsourmainfocushasbeenourhomevisitingservice.However,ourgroupsupportisnow well
establishedacrosstheBoroughinGodalming,FarnhamandCranleigh.Forsomeparentsthesegroupsarea lifeline
andtheyprovideasafeenvironmenttodiscussissuesanddispelthefeelingsofisolation.Followingrequests from
parents, we have developed a parent focused group in Godalming to support Mental Health.
```

## **`Finances`** 

```
We owe an enormousthankyouto ourmanyfunderswhohavecontinuedto supportus thisyear.Withoutthem we
would be unable to help our many families.
```

```
The fundingmarketplacehastightenedstillfurtherthisyear.The manycutbacksacrosscentralandlocal government
have meant many more charitiesare applyingto the same fundersas ourselves.In severalcases fundersare asking us
to rebid with others rather than singly.
```

```
Decisionmakinghas been a lot slowerand oftenfundingcriteriahas changedparticularlywith the largerfunders. We
have workedhardto managethe extra challengesbut inevitablythe uncertaintyin the marketplacehas impacted our
own ability to plan ahead. Thankfully by the end of the year we were just short of our planned budget figure.
```

## **`Going forward`** 

```
This year has been our 27th year supportingdisadvantagedfamiliesin Waverley.Every year we have said we can  only
see the need for our support growing. This year is no exception!
```

```
Onceagain,wehavethesamesignificantchallengesahead.Firstly,weneedtomaintainourfundingina very
competitivefundingmarketplace.Secondly,weneedtokeeprecruitingmorevolunteersdespitethe widespread
shortage.Many more people who would have volunteerednow need to keep workingto combat the increasedcost of
living or are supporting their own families.
```

```
And finally,we are keepinga close watchon the proposalto replacethe currentSurreycouncilstructurewith unitary
councils.Itisunclearhowthiswillaffectusbutwedoanticipateaperiodofuncertaintywhilethesemajor changes
settle down.

## **`Notes to the Financial Statements for the Year Ended 31 March 2025`** 

## **`1. ACCOUNTING POLICIES`** 

## **`Basis of preparing the financial statements`** 

```
The financialstatementsof the charitablecompany,whichis a publicbenefitentityunderFRS 102,have been
preparedinaccordancewiththeCharitiesSORP(FRS102)'AccountingandReportingbyCharities: Statement
ofRecommendedPracticeapplicabletocharitiespreparingtheiraccountsinaccordancewiththe Financial
ReportingStandardapplicablein the UK and Republicof Ireland(FRS 102) (effective1 January2019)', Financial
ReportingStandard102 'The FinancialReportingStandardapplicablein the UK and Republicof Ireland'and the
Companies Act 2006. The financial statements have been prepared under the historical cost convention.
```

## **`Income`** 

```
All incomeis recognisedin the Statementof FinancialActivitiesoncethe charityhasentitlementto the funds,
it is probable that the income will be received and the amount can be measured reliably.
```

```
Incomefromgrantswithperformancerelatedconditionsis recognisedonlytotheextentthatthecharity has
provided the specified goods or services.
```

## **`Expenditure`** 

```
Liabilitiesarerecognisedasexpenditureassoonasthereisalegalorconstructiveobligationcommitting the
charitytothatexpenditure,itisprobablethatatransferofeconomicbenefitswillberequiredin settlement
andtheamountof theobligationcanbe measuredreliably.Expenditureis accountedforonanaccruals basis
andhas been classifiedunderheadingsthataggregateall costrelatedto the category.Wherecostscannot be
directlyattributedtoparticularheadingstheyhavebeenallocatedtoactivitiesonabasisconsistentwith the
use of resources.
```

## **`Tangible fixed assets`** 

```
Depreciationis providedat the followingannualrates in orderto write off each asset over its estimated useful
life.
```

```
IT equipment & software- Straight line over 5 years
```

## **`Taxation`** 

```
The charity is exempt from corporation tax on its charitable activities.
```

## **`Fund accounting`** 

```
Unrestricted funds can be used in accordance with the charitable objectives at the discretion of the trustees.
```

```
Restrictedfundscanonlybeusedforparticularrestrictedpurposeswithintheobjectsofthe charity.
Restrictions arise when specified by the donor or when funds are raised for particular restricted purposes.
```

```
Furtherexplanationofthenatureandpurposeofeachfundisincludedinthenotestothe financial
statements.
